Output 89c0b51ad2d78d32dfa5d15e71b9493c9a6343ac594f94e809a5c1933a32edca:0

value
1597201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f22fe7b8c815d47e66e470353f608b446d132b73 OP_EQUAL
address
3PmaqUYtcSTsCuug2xohUpHWyUoYZwXGJJ
transaction
89c0b51ad2d78d32dfa5d15e71b9493c9a6343ac594f94e809a5c1933a32edca
confirmations
392475
spent
true